Michael, under Target Light orders, 60 and 81mm on map mortars would fire around 3 rounds per minute, as opposed to 7-8 per minute (IIRC) under normal Target orders. Bulletpoint, I haven't noticed mortar team rifles firing under TL in 4.0, but then again I haven't been watching for it either.

This matches my experience. I believe mortar teams are only intended to use their rifles in self defense. Ammo bearers will however accept normal infantry fire orders.

Sounds like a bug if you're seeing something different.

I've experienced this situation with 4.0 CM:Normandy, particularly with American 60mm mortar teams. I had have one crew popping off .30 cal carbine rounds at the direct fire target. I always found it amusing, because the other guys are working on sighting-in and re-loading the mortar -- and he's just trying to contribute:

"Take this, Krauts!"

At longer ranges (100m ~300m), the shooter's rate of fire was completely ineffective. It's important to note that sometimes, especially in the hedgerows, soldiers will shoot off small weapons at suspected targets. Considering I used direct fire on 95% confirmed static targets,it could be that they were just doing this out of their own accord.

I did often notice these guys putting rounds down range when HE ammo was spent, but the direct target order was still on for that turn.That, I suppose, is by design. I always had rifle squads protecting the platoon's mortar, which I often placed in cover and concealment. The Germans concentrated on suppressing the rifles and rarely cared about the mortars -- as they were a less-direct existential threat.
